Roasted Butternut Squash with Cranberries

This colorful side dish combines sweet roasted butternut squash with tart cranberries, creamy goat cheese, and crunchy pistachios for a perfect fall or holiday side dish.

 

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 medium butternut squash, peeled, seeded, and cut into cubes
  • 4 teaspoons extra virgin olive oil, divided
  • 5 shallots, thinly sliced
  • 3 garlic cloves, chopped
  • ½ cup fresh or dried cranberries
  • 2 teaspoons chopped fresh sage
  • 4 ounces goat cheese, crumbled
  • 2 tablespoons chopped pistachios
  • 1 tablespoon balsamic vinegar
  • Kosher salt, to taste
  • Freshly ground black pepper, to taste

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 425°F. Place butternut squash cubes in a 9×9-inch baking dish, drizzle with 2 teaspoons olive oil, and season with salt and pepper. Toss to coat and roast for 30-35 minutes, stirring halfway, until tender.
  2. Meanwhile, heat remaining oil in a skillet over medium heat. Add shallots and salt, cooking for 15 minutes until caramelized. Add garlic, balsamic vinegar, and sage, cooking 2 more minutes until garlic softens.
  3. Remove squash from oven, add shallot mixture and cranberries, stirring gently to combine.
  4. Sprinkle goat cheese and pistachios over the top. Return to oven for 10-15 minutes until cheese is warm and softened.
  5. Serve warm with additional fresh herbs if desired.

Notes

For best results, cut squash into uniform cubes for even cooking. Dried cranberries can be substituted for fresh ones. This dish can be prepared a day ahead through step 3, then refrigerated and finished just before serving.
